Differential cross sections for weak-field gravitational scattering
Phys. Rev. D 13, 775 – Published 15 February, 1976
DOI: https://doi.org/10.1103/PhysRevD.13.775
Abstract
Differential cross sections are presented for the scattering of plane scalar, electromagnetic, and gravitational waves from the gravitational field of sources in the weak-field approximation. Comparison is made with the long-wavelength limit of analogous scattering off of spherical black holes.
